Which statement about the environmental fate of copper algicides is true?

Explanation:
Copper algicides behave as metals in the environment. When they enter water, they tend to form insoluble compounds such as copper hydroxide or basic copper carbonates, which drop out of solution and settle into the sediment or bind to sediment particles and organic matter. This makes sedimentation the dominant fate path for dissolved copper in many aquatic systems. Metals are not biodegradable, so they aren’t broken down by microbes, and they aren’t volatile, so they don’t evaporate. So the idea that copper compounds precipitate to sediment best describes their environmental fate.
